In the construction industry, round steel bars are often integrated into reinforced concrete systems to improve tensile strength. Concrete is strong in compression but weak in tension, and steel reinforcement solves this limitation effectively. By embedding round steel bars within concrete, builders create composite structures that can resist both compressive and tensile forces. This combination has become the foundation of modern construction techniques used in buildings, dams, and highways.
